Yellow Split Pea Dhal – Little Big H
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es
Total Time 55 minutes
- 2 cups yellow split peas
- 4 cloves garlic ,crushed
- 1 tomato ,chopped
- 2 tsp salt
- 1 small red chilli ,chopped *optional
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 onion ,sliced
- 1/2 tsp whole cumin seeds
- 1 tsp brown mustard seeds
- 1 tsp turmeric
- 50 grams butter ,optional*
- To serve: natural yoghurt, coriander, hemp seeds, sweet chutney ,optional*
- Add yellow split peas to a large saucepan with half the garlic, tomato, salt and chilli if using. Add 6 cups water and bring to the boil. Skim off any froth that forms on the surface, this will stop it boiling over.
- Continue boiling, adding an extra 4 cups of water as the liquid absorbs, for 45 minutes or until the split peas are tender and falling apart. Stir often to ensure if doesn’t stick.
- Once the dhal is cooked add oil to a large saucepan or pan and fry the onion until tender, add garlic and spices and continue to fry until just browned.
- Add the split peas to the fried onion, being careful it doesn’t splatter. Stir to combine. Turn off heat and add butter if using, combine well. Adjust seasoning.
- Serve with rice, natural yoghurt, fresh coriander, hemp seeds and sweet chutney – or simply on its own.
This makes a large batch of dhal so freeze what you don’t use for another day. The butter is optional but does make it extra delicious and silky.
